Recent excavation and Survey in the Walton Basin
The on-going excavation and survey projects focused around Walton and Hindwell in eastern Radnorshire was the subject of a talk in the Arkwright Hall, Kinsham by CPAT's Nigel Jones on the 10th November. The evening was organised by the Byton, Combe, Kinsham and Stapleton History Group, with around 60 people packing into the hall to hear the results of recent work. The talk focused on recent work to investigate a number of important Neolithic sites, including the
Womaston causewayed enclosure
, the palisaded enclosures at Walton
and Hindwell, a potential
cursus at Hindwell
, an unusually large ring ditch at
Walton Court Farm.
Bringing the story right up to date the final section of the talk focused on a geophysical survey by the Trust around Hindwell Roman fort, the results from which were hot off the press that very morning.
